Idk if it's been mentioned, but I just noticed on the order sheet from my distro that the LE has a Laser-cut Topper. (CE has the moving ship in a bottle topper).

Other LE features: 72-light Starfield on back panel, invisiglass, shaker motor, powder coated armor and legs
Interesting that the LE won't get a printed manual (DI buyers should get them, once available).

Not that I want to compare JJP to the other manufacturers, but I just have to say, "to each their own." My collection is limited by space and not $$. The value is there when comparing a $7,000 premium stern to a $9,000 JJP pin.

I like that this game has something for the competitive player, collector, and operator in mind. I wasn't high on the theme, but they executed it wonderfully (and Keith said at the end of the Buffalo stream that it's only 20% done). Shipping 1Q (3 monhs up from last year). Well done.
